About Shiosai
Nestled in the alleys of a former fishing village in Setoda, "Shiosai (潮彩)" stands in quiet dignity.
Before it stretches the Setoda Strait, and from the second-floor window, you can gaze upon golden sunsets painting the sea, layered ridgelines of blue and green islands.
These three colors — gold, blue, and green — are also the thematic palette of Ikuo Hirayama, a Japanese painter born here in Setoda.
Shiosai is located right next to the birthplace of Hirayama.
The name "Shiosai (潮彩)" comes from the ever-changing colors of the Setoda Strait as light shifts through the day.
It also carries quiet reverence for Hirayama's words: "Raised amid the tides of Seto, I walk my own path."

Access
Access
Setoda, Setoda-cho, Onomichi City, Hiroshima 722-2411 (Opening soon)
⛴ Ferry
Take a ferry from Mihara Port or Onomichi Port to Setoda Port on Ikuchijima.
Shiosai is within walking distance from Setoda Port.
Sanyo Kisen (Mihara–Setoda) or Ishizaki Kisen (Onomichi–Setoda).
🚴 Bicycle / Motorcycle (Shimanami Kaido)
Cyclists and motorcyclists on the Shimanami Kaido are very welcome.
Shiosai is within walking distance from Setoda Port. Bicycle parking is available.
🚗 By Car
About 60 min from Onomichi IC (Nishiseto Expressway) via Ikuchijima-kita IC.
